Item description from the seller
This product is widely used in engineering machinery, aerial work vehicles, excavators, agricultural machinery and other fields.
Product Features
Standardized design: Provides over 400 standard product types, covering pressure, flow, and direction control functions.
High reliability: adopting a conical sealing structure, with minimal leakage, suitable for viscous media such as emulsions.
High flow rate: The flow rate can reach 379 liters per minute (100 gallons per minute), and the pressure can reach 350 bar (5000 pounds per square inch).
Lightweight: It can significantly reduce the size and weight of hydraulic systems.
Application field
Aerial work vehicle: controls walking, braking, steering, and lifting functions.
Excavator: Used for pilot control, boom control, and auxiliary equipment operation.
Agricultural machinery: widely used in equipment such as combine harvesters and cotton harvesters.
Construction machinery: including tractors, loaders, mining trucks, etc., used for gearbox shifting and shock absorption systems.
preventive measures
During installation, attention should be paid to the impact of changes in load pressure on internal control to avoid accidental displacement of the valve core.
To avoid sharing the return oil pipeline, it is recommended to set up a separate oil discharge pipeline to reduce impact pressure interference.
